Maison > base de données > tutoriel mysql > le corps du texte

modification du mot de passe root mysql

王林
Libérer: 2023-05-08 16:56:37
original
785 Les gens l'ont consulté

MySQL est un système de gestion de bases de données relationnelles open source et l'un des outils importants dans le développement d'applications Web. MySQL nécessite qu'un utilisateur autorisé se connecte pour s'exécuter. L'utilisateur root de MySQL possède la plus haute autorité et peut effectuer n'importe quelle opération sur la base de données, c'est pourquoi il fait souvent l'objet d'attaques de la part des attaquants. Par conséquent, il est très nécessaire de changer régulièrement le mot de passe de l'utilisateur root MySQL. Cet article explique comment modifier le mot de passe root MySQL.

  1. Entrez MySQL

Vous devez d'abord entrer MySQL, vous pouvez utiliser la commande suivante :

mysql -u root -p
Copier après la connexion

Cette commande vous demandera de saisir le mot de passe de l'utilisateur root. Si vous entrez correctement, vous entrerez MySQL.

  1. Changer le mot de passe

Après avoir entré MySQL, vous devez utiliser la commande suivante pour changer le mot de passe :

S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password');
Copier après la connexion

Parmi eux, newpassword est le nouveau mot de passe que vous souhaitez définir. Notez l'utilisation de guillemets simples.

Si vous souhaitez que l'utilisateur root accède à MySQL depuis n'importe où, pas seulement depuis localhost, vous pouvez utiliser la commande suivante :

SET PASSWORD FOR 'root'@'%' = PASSWORD('newpassword');
Copier après la connexion

Encore une fois, où newpassword est le nouveau mot de passe que vous souhaitez définir.

  1. Actualiser les autorisations

Après avoir modifié le mot de passe, vous devez actualiser les autorisations MySQL pour le rendre efficace. Vous pouvez utiliser la commande suivante pour actualiser les autorisations :

FLUSH PRIVILEGES;
Copier après la connexion
  1. Quitter MySQL

Une fois la modification terminée, vous devez également utiliser la commande suivante pour quitter MySQL :

exit;
Copier après la connexion

À ce stade, le mot de passe de l'utilisateur root MySQL la modification est terminée.

Rappelons qu'il est recommandé de définir un mot de passe complexe et suffisamment long, et de changer régulièrement le mot de passe pour augmenter la sécurité de MySQL.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al